You are booking hotel for more than 90 days
City Center - Centro, Madrid | 6 minutes walk to Puerta del Sol - City Centre
Salamanca
Retiro
Tetuan
City Center - Centro
Hortaleza
La Montaña
Salamanca
Toledo
Badajoz
Valencia Airport
Zamora
Palencia
Badajoz
City Center - Centro
Toledo
Ponferrada City Center
Chamberi
Salamanca
City Center - Centro
City Center - Centro
City Center - Centro
City Center - Centro
Chamberi
Salamanca
City Center - Centro
Salamanca
Salamanca
Moncloa - Aravaca
Tetuan
City Center - Centro
City Center - Centro
City Center - Centro
Barajas
Albacete City Center
Burgos City Center
Segovia City Center
Salamanca City Center
Cuenca City Center
Cuenca City Center
Universidad
Avinguda Del Raco
Ciutat Vella (City Center)